WebJul 28, 2024 · Here is my code so far: # imports import openpyxl as py from openpyxl import Workbook, load_workbook # create a workbook and active worksheet wb = load_workbook (r'MERGEDSHEETS.xlsx') print (wb.sheetnames) ws = wb.active for sheet [L2:, M2:]: py.strip () wb.save (r'MERGEDSHEETSv2.xlsx') python python-3.x excel … WebNov 3, 2024 · OpenPyXL doesn’t require Microsoft Excel to be installed, and it works on all platforms. You can install OpenPyXL using pip: $ python -m pip install openpyxl. After …
openpyxl.cell.cell module — openpyxl 3.1.2 documentation
WebMar 29, 2024 · import openpyxl xlsx = openpyxl.load_workbook ('workbook.xlsx') sheet = xlsx.active for row in sheet: for cell in row: for element in cell: if ord (element) ==188: element.replace (chr (188), '1/4') xlsx.save ('workbook.xlsx') python excel Share Improve this question Follow asked Mar 29, 2024 at 18:58 404mind 15 2 WebOct 10, 2024 · with pd.ExcelWriter ('/path/to/file.xlsx',engine = "openpyxl", mode='a') as writer: workBook = writer.book try: workBook.remove (workBook ['Town_names']) except: print ("worksheet doesn't exist") finally: df.to_excel (writer, sheet_name='Town_names') writer.save () Share Improve this answer Follow answered Oct 11, 2024 at 3:07 Yugandhar factors that affect calcium absorption
Find & Replace Values in Multiple Excel Files using Python …
WebAug 11, 2024 · from openpyxl import Workbook import openpyxl file = "enter_path_to_file_here" wb = openpyxl.load_workbook (file, read_only=True) ws = wb.active for row in ws.iter_rows ("E"): for cell in row: if cell.value == "ABC": print (ws.cell (row=cell.row, column=2).value) #change column number for any cell value you want … WebMar 17, 2024 · import pandas as pd df = pd.read_excel (r'location\excelfile.xlsx') df.loc [:,column_name] = df.replace (to_replace= ['987888','987888'.....],value= ['F3','F4']) df.to_excel (r'save loc\filename.xlsx') This should give you an idea I hope. Note that you will loose all the formatting in you original excel file. Share Improve this answer Follow WebDec 10, 2015 · import openpyxl #Path wb = openpyxl.load_workbook (r'PathOfTheFile') #active worksheet data ws = wb.active def wordfinder (searchString): for i in range (1, ws.max_row + 1): for j in range (1, ws.max_column + 1): if searchString == ws.cell (i,j).value: print ("found") print (ws.cell (i,j)) wordfinder ("YourString") Hope this helps. P.S. factors that affect car insurance premiums